Kyoko Okamura is a scholar working on Oncology, Surgery and Molecular Biology. According to data from OpenAlex, Kyoko Okamura has authored 22 papers receiving a total of 513 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Oncology, 4 papers in Surgery and 4 papers in Molecular Biology. Recurrent topics in Kyoko Okamura's work include Tuberculosis Research and Epidemiology (3 papers), Vascular Tumors and Angiosarcomas (2 papers) and Child Nutrition and Water Access (2 papers). Kyoko Okamura is often cited by papers focused on Tuberculosis Research and Epidemiology (3 papers), Vascular Tumors and Angiosarcomas (2 papers) and Child Nutrition and Water Access (2 papers). Kyoko Okamura collaborates with scholars based in Japan, United States and Australia. Kyoko Okamura's co-authors include Koichi Takayama, Yoichi Nakanishi, Taishi Harada, Kazuto Furuyama, Miiru Izumi, Judith Bernstein, Kayo Ijichi, Ellen W. Seely, Tatsuro Okamoto and Takaomi Koga and has published in prestigious journals such as British Journal of Pharmacology, Clinical Endocrinology and Cancer Science.
